Note, incidentally, that although False Cure causes someone to lose twice the life they gain, they still gain the life, so Skyshroud Cutter, for example, is a net of -5 life, not -10 life.

Discussion:  All the creatures minus Teferi are basically free or + mana to my mana pool.  The idea is to aid to brain freeze's storm and to simply keep me from getting killed.  That said Teferi is the icing on the cake.  I'd like to cast Teferi the turn before I cast Haunting Echoes or Traumatize or etc etc... to keep the level of success at a higher rate or completely avert  counters by having them use it on Teferi as opposed to the spell that will DECK them.  Teferi can also be used to slip into combat and kill an unsuspecting attacker who only sees faeries, walkers, and thopters.  Ideally; for the Faeries I have gotten the academy out one way or another bypassing the need for other means of massive mana production.

Discussion:  Horn of Greed mandates drawing a card for each land put out (I'm more efficient they're closer to getting decked).  Grindstone and Millstone are the basics for the job and Whetstone is for more massive amounts (or after I've tapped grind/mill).  Mesmeric orb is kind of the more aggressive one that also decks me, but if I can get yawgmoth's will in my hand it will really aid a lot to finishing off w/e is left of their deck.  Crumbling sanctuary can play a HUGE role in winning the game by stalling even more and again building my graveyard if yawgmoth's will shows up.  Howling mine although some may think it will help the opponent more than me is a pivotal role in not needing the likes of brainstorm and aiding to the cause of decking the opponent.  I get to draw more cards (some that take 10 or more from library to graveyard) that will deck them faster than they can dish out the lethal damage to kill me.
